Copiague, NY vs Utica, NY
The cost of living difference between Copiague, NY and Utica, NY is dramatic. Utica is 94.9% cheaper than Copiague,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Copiague has a cost index of 138 while Utica sits at 71,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.
On the housing front, median rent in Copiague is $2,003/month compared to $907/month in Utica — a 121%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Utica is more affordable at $133,400 median vs $463,300.
Median household income in Copiague is $121,098 compared to $51,513 in Utica (+135.1%). While Copiague is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Copiague spend roughly 19.8% of their income on rent, less than the 21.1% in Utica.
